Further explanations of the -de ending.
This ending translates to - in, at, on (in other words no movement from).
There are two other endings that you will need to learn. All 3 endings follow the e type vowel harmony.
-e to (movement to)
-den from (movement from)
A quick recap on the e type vowel harmony
e harmonizes best with i, e, ö, ü
a harmonizes best with ı, a, o, u
An example sentence
Bankada otur Sit at the bank
